Windscreens have become the hub for sensors that support advanced driver safety systems, increasing the complexity of glass replacement

Cameras, sensors, radar, lidar, head-up display… vehicle windscreens have become the focal point of advanced driver assistance systems (ADAS) in a technological revolution that has fundamentally changed the nature of glass repair and replacement.

While autonomous emergency braking, lane-assist and adaptive cruise control features have dramatically improved driver and vehicle safety, the need to recalibrate their associated sensors and radars when a windscreen is replaced have complicated the repair process.

As many as 75% of new vehicles, not just luxury models, but also mainstream cars and vans, now require a static calibration of their safety features when the windscreen is replaced, increasing the time the work takes and requiring a much greater proportion of vehicles to visit a dedicated windscreen workshop rather than rely on the convenience of a mobile service.

The time it takes to replace the glass and then the recalibration process means a job that used to take an hour or two can now take the better part of a morning or afternoon.

“Our fitting centres are investing heavily to provide drivers with the experience they need, creating work zones for customers, and offering WiFi and free coffee, similar to the latest car dealership showrooms,” said Hunt.

Mobile windscreen replacement is still available, but the vast majority of calibrations are carried out in controlled environments with adequate lighting and level ground to ensure accuracy.

Glass repair, however, is the preferred approach (National Windscreens pledges never to replace a damaged screen if a repair can be undertaken) from both a cost and environmental perspective, saving time, money and carbon. Pressed by its insurer partners to calculate its Scope 1, 2 and 3 greenhouse gas emissions, National Windscreens has calculated that a repair generates about 1kg of carbon, compared with 44kg for a windscreen replacement, a saving that helps fleet customers meet their own environmental, social and governance (ESG) targets. Repairing and replacing thousands of car, van and truck windscreens gives National Windscreens a unique insight not only into the likelihood of a make and model suffering a chip or crack, but also into variances in glass replacement costs between vehicles, based on the price of the screen and the work involved in recalibrating all of their ADAS sensors. This data could eventually be factored into total cost of ownership calculations for leasing companies, end user fleets and insurers.

“Vehicle complexity is increasing at a fast pace and this creates huge challenges for fleets looking to stay ahead of the curve when selecting new vehicles, when they have little historical data available on repair downtime and maintenance costs associated with the advanced technology now usually on board as standard,” said Hunt. “We supply 30 of the FN50 leasing companies and all of them want data insights into future costs from an SMR (service, maintenance and repair)perspective.”

The costs involved in replacing wind­screens that extend into panoramic roofs, for example, are so much higher than for standard windscreens that leasing companies and insurers have an interest in factoring the risk into their rentals and premiums.
